audiobooks.com Annual Revenue and Growth
audiobooks.com's annual sales on its online store amounted to $17.4M in 2025, down 20-50% from the previous year. For 2026, revenue is expected to grow by 5-10%. This suggests a turnaround from last year's decline.

audiobooks.com competitors
As of May 2026, audiobooks.com generated a revenue of $1,283,743 from 12,739 transactions over 1,611,621 sessions, with an average order value (AOV) ranging between $100-125 and a conversion rate of 0.50-1.00%. In comparison, kobo.com outperformed significantly with a revenue of $5,265,084 and a higher conversion rate of 2.00-2.50%, despite its lower AOV of $25-50. penguinrandomhouse.com dominated with the highest revenue at $15,636,446 and a strong AOV of $225-250, but its conversion rate matched that of audiobooks.com at 0.50-1.00%. booksamillion.com showed decent results with $1,997,299 in revenue and a conversion rate of 1.00-1.50%, alongside an AOV of $50-75. Overall, while audiobooks.com performs well in niche markets, it still lags behind larger competitors in revenue and transaction volume.
Revenue share by device at audiobooks.com
In May large majority of sales on audiobooks.com, 75% was finalized on desktop devices, with 25% of sales coming from mobile devices (mobile web only, excluding app usage, if relevant).
